Output 8427aec1aebb510e818f26bdba3db5125087f9feb21b53bb26aeffc6b9d61766:2

value
48504
script pubkey
OP_0 OP_PUSHBYTES_20 8a5cbb81188ebcc5f253a27fe5db3e49201f0237
address
bc1q3fwthqgc367vtujn5fl7tke7fysp7q3h9xdpua
transaction
8427aec1aebb510e818f26bdba3db5125087f9feb21b53bb26aeffc6b9d61766
confirmations
37968
spent
true